Tax deeds are recorded in the county real estate records.With that distinction in mind, I'll try to answer your questions:Properties with outstanding tax liens are sold all the time - the closing attorney pays off the tax liens with the proceeds from the sale just like he or she would pay off an outstanding mortgage or any other lien on the property.If a property is sold at a tax sale, the previous owner can't sell it to someone else without first redeeming the tax deed.
